What's a singular noun
Ksju [112]
A singular non is the opposite of a plural noun. A plural noun names more than one person, place, thing, or idea. A plural noun includes things like "children," "books," "libraries," or "liberties." A singular noun would be "child," "book," "library," and "liberty." Singular nouns only name one person, place, thing, or idea. Hope this helps.

Which words are the adjectives in the following sentence?The play is about earning genuine respect and reaching admirable goals.
Andre45 [30]

The words in the sentence "The play is about earning genuine respect and reaching admirable goals" which are adjectives are:

The, genuine and admirable.

An adjective is a word that modifies a noun by giving it a quality.

In English, adjectives are placed before the word they modify.

Examples of adjectives are:<u> beautiful, smart, big, short, long, colorful, strange, etc.</u>

In the sentence "The play is about earning genuine respect and reaching admirable goals," there are three adjectives.

The first is "genuine", and it modifies the noun "respect". The second is "admirable", and it modifies the noun "goals".

Now, the word "the" is usually described as a definite article. However, since it can help specify a noun, modifying it, it is also considered an adjective.

For that reason, "the" is included in the list as the third adjective.
